Understanding the Rise of PayID Casinos Australia

The Australian gambling landscape has seen a steady shift towards integrating more efficient payment methods, with PayID standing out as a popular choice. This system offers near-instantaneous bank transfers, allowing players to deposit and withdraw funds quickly without the usual delays of traditional banking options. PayID leverages the New Payments Platform (NPP), a fast payment infrastructure developed for Australian banks, enabling payments to be processed within seconds. This means that users avoid the frustrating wait times often associated with methods like bank transfers or credit card transactions. Key Features and Benefits of Using PayID at Online Casinos

When considering payment options for online casinos, convenience and security usually top the list. PayID addresses both by linking a user’s bank account to a simple identifier—such as a phone number or email address—removing the need to remember complex account details. This ease of use is a major draw for many.

Another benefit is transparency. Unlike credit cards or e-wallets, PayID transfers are direct bank-to-bank payments, which often carry lower fees and reduce the risk of fraud. Many casinos offering PayID also implement SSL encryption and comply with the Australian Transaction Reports and Analysis Centre (AUSTRAC) guidelines, further protecting players’ financial data.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id When Using PayID at Casinos

Despite its advantages, PayID isn’t flawless. One common mistake is neglecting to check the exact processing times for withdrawals, which can vary between casinos depending on their banking partners. Some players expect instant payouts and might be disappointed if additional verification steps delay transactions.

Another issue arises from input errors when setting up PayID details; a simple typo in an email or phone number can redirect funds, causing unnecessary headaches. Always double-check your PayID information before confirming any transaction.

Finally, while PayID itself is secure, not all casinos maintain the same level of cybersecurity. It’s crucial to avoid platforms without SSL encryption or those that don’t adhere to Australian gambling regulations.
